Criteria for Registered Agents and Legal Compliance When establishing a company such as a corp or an Limited Liability Company, one of the key requirements is appointing a registered agent. A registered representative must be a inhabitant of the state where the entity is situated or a firm that delivers registered agent services in that region. This agent acts as the representative for service of process, meaning they are accountable for receiving legal documents, including lawsuits and official government correspondence, ensuring that the business remains in compliance with regulatory requirements. In addition to residency requirements, registered representatives must have a tangible location within the region, which serves as the registered office. This address cannot be a mailbox; it needs to be a site where the registered agent can be located during normal business hours. Noncompliance to comply with these criteria can lead to consequences, including the difficulty to respond to claims and the potential administrative dissolution of the company. Compliance with laws goes further than just naming a registered agent. Businesses must ensure that their representative meets ongoing requirements, such as having correct contact details and timely replying to court papers. Regular monitoring of compliance and yearly renewal of agent services are essential to avoid any lapses that could jeopardize the entity’s good standing with the authorities. Expense Evaluation of RA Solutions As evaluating RA services, it is important to analyze the associated expenses to ensure that you are making a wise decision for your business entity. Registered agent costs can vary significantly based on the company and the services they provide. Basic registered agent services usually range from inexpensive options at about 50 to 300 dollars each year. However, additional services such as compliance reminders, mail forwarding, and legal document handling can add to these expenses. It's important to compare various registered agent companies to identify the best value for the solutions offered. In addition to the base fees, it's also beneficial to consider any further costs that may arise later. For instance, RA renewal costs may be charged each year, and some companies charge extra for services like filing annual reports or notifications related to compliance.
